Drawings
The present invention will be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ings and specific embodiments.
FIG. 1 is a schematic view showing the overall structure of a neck joint rehabilitation device;
FIG. 2 is a schematic view of the overall structure of a cervical joint rehabilitation device;
FIG. 3 is a schematic view of the connecting frame and threaded rod;
FIG. 4 is a schematic view of the structure of the connecting plate and the sliding housing;
FIG. 5 is a schematic view of the structure of the chin support section I;
FIG. 6 is a schematic view of the structure of the lower jaw support II;
fig. 7 is a schematic structural view of the connection plate and the head support plate.
In the figure: a connecting frame 101; a threaded rod 102; a slide bar 103; a rocking handle 104; a connecting plate 201; a slide case 202; a set screw 203; a limiting strip 204; a friction rubber strip 205; a neck joint support plate 301; a head support plate 302; a chin support section I401; a rubber gasket I402; a buffer rubber strip 403; a chin support section II 501; a rubber gasket II 502; the fitting groove 503.
Detailed Description
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, there are shown schematic views of embodiments of the present invention for facilitating rehabilitation therapy of neck correction for different persons, and further,
in the device, two sliding shells 202 are connected on a connecting plate 201 in a sliding manner, a neck joint supporting plate 301 is fixedly connected on the connecting plate 201, a lower jaw supporting part I401 is connected in one sliding shell 202 in a sliding manner, a lower jaw supporting part II 501 is connected in the other sliding shell 202 in a sliding manner, and the lower jaw supporting part I401 can be inserted into the lower jaw supporting part II 501. when the device is used, a user firstly slides the two sliding shells 202 to slide the lower jaw supporting part I401 and the lower jaw supporting part II 501 to be opened, then extends a neck into a gap between the lower jaw supporting part I401 and the lower jaw supporting part II 501, then slides the two sliding shells 202 to operate the combination of the supporting part I401 and the lower jaw supporting part II 501, places a lower jaw on the lower jaw supporting part I401 and the lower jaw supporting part II to support the lower jaw after sliding to a proper position, so as to be convenient for supporting the lower jaw, and then adjusts the lower jaw supporting part I401 and the lower jaw supporting part II to slide in the two sliding shells 202, thereby make I401 of chin supporting part and II 501 of chin supporting part move forward or backward, fix I401 of chin supporting part and II 501 of chin supporting part after arriving suitable position, thereby make neck joint backup pad 301 push up patient's neck, thereby the realization can carry out the effect of the rehabilitation of neck correction to the user, through adjusting the position of I401 of chin supporting part and II 501 of chin supporting part in two slip shells 202, make this device can adjust the correction size according to different patients, thereby make this device can be to different face types, the people of different necks carries out cervical vertebra rehabilitation, thereby improve the application range of this device, make this device use more nimble.
Referring to fig. 5-6, there are shown schematic views of an embodiment of the present invention for providing soft support to the chin of a patient, and further,
rubber gasket I402 fixed connection is on I401 of chin supporting part in this device, two II 502 fixed connection of rubber gasket are on II 501 of chin supporting part, slide I401 of chin supporting part and II 501 of chin supporting part to suitable position back at the patient, place the chin on I401 of chin supporting part and II 501 of chin supporting part, thereby make I401 of chin supporting part and II 501 of chin supporting part support the patient chin, this moment because I402 of rubber gasket and II 502 of rubber gasket can carry out soft support to the patient chin, thereby increase the travelling comfort of patient in correcting the treatment process.
Referring to fig. 6, there is shown a schematic view of an embodiment of the present invention for facilitating insertion of a chin support portion i 401 into a chin support portion ii 501, and further,
because the cooperation groove 503 is set up on chin support portion II 501, can insert rubber gasket I402 in the cooperation groove 503, the setting of cooperation groove 503 can make the less user of neck carry out the chin support in needing slip shell 202 with chin support portion I401 to insert chin support portion II 501, and rubber gasket I402 can not cause the hindrance in inserting chin support portion I401 into chin support portion II 501.
Referring to fig. 4-5, there are shown schematic views of embodiments of the present invention for avoiding injury to a patient's neck, and further,
two buffering adhesive tape 403 set up respectively on lower jaw supporting part I401 and lower jaw supporting part II 501 in this device, if the patient can guarantee carrying out the neck and correcting the rehabilitation in-process carrying on lower jaw supporting part I401 and lower jaw supporting part II 501, if the patient is when appearing unexpected touch lower jaw supporting part I401 or lower jaw supporting part II 501 of emergency, buffering adhesive tape 403 can guarantee that lower jaw supporting part I401 and lower jaw supporting part II 501 can not cause the injury to the patient.
Referring to fig. 7, a schematic view of an embodiment of the present invention for supporting a patient's head is shown, and further,
fixedly connected with head backup pad 302 in this device on the neck joint backup pad 301 pushes up patient's neck at neck joint backup pad 301, and head backup pad 302 can support patient's head when carrying out the rehabilitation of neck correction to the user to improve the recovered effect of correction of neck joint backup pad 301 to patient's neck.
Referring to fig. 4, a schematic view of an embodiment of the present invention that enables two sliding housings 202 to slide to any position for fixing is shown, and further,
two friction rubber strips 205 in this device set up respectively in two slip shells 202 and connecting plate 201 sliding connection department, and two friction rubber strips 205's setting can guarantee that two slip shells 202 can slide to connecting plate 201 optional position after the patient is operating, and two slip shells 202 can be fixed in this position automatically.
Referring to fig. 7, there is shown a schematic view of an embodiment of the present invention in which a chin support part i 401 and a chin support part ii 501 are fixed in two sliding housings 202, and further,
two set screw 203 of threaded connection respectively in two slip shells 202 in this device, slide to suitable position back in two slip shells 202 at patient operation chin support portion I401 and chin support portion II 501, can fix chin support portion I401 and chin support portion II 501 through screwing up two set screw 203.
Referring to fig. 4, there is shown a schematic view of an embodiment of preventing two sliding housings 202 from being separated from a connection plate 201 according to the present invention, and further,
two spacing strips 204 set up on connecting plate 201 in this device, and sliding connection has two slip shells 202 on two spacing strips 204, and two slip shells 202 can be guaranteed to slide on connecting plate 201 in the setting of two spacing strips 204, can not appear two slip shells 202 and break away from the condition of connecting plate 201.
Referring to fig. 3, there is shown a schematic view of an embodiment of the present invention for facilitating treatment of patients of different heights, and further,
two sliding strip 103 of fixedly connected with on link 101 in this device, sliding connection has connecting plate 201 on two sliding strip 103, and two screw holes set up on link 101, can slide on two sliding strip 103 through operation connecting plate 201 during the use of this device to be convenient for treat the patient of different heights, thereby can be through to two threaded hole internal screw screws of twist simultaneously with link 101 fixed connection in the chair of patient's family, the patient of being convenient for uses.
Referring to fig. 3, there is shown a schematic view of an embodiment of the drive link plate 201 sliding on two slide bars 103 according to the present invention, and further,
since the connecting frame 101 is rotatably connected to the threaded rod 102, and the rocking handle 104 is fixedly connected to the threaded rod 102, when the connecting plate 201 needs to be operated to slide on the two sliders 103, the rocking handle 104 can be rocked to rotate the threaded rod 102, so that the connecting plate 201 is driven to slide on the two sliders 103.
